debug
node-red

Node-RED で値を簡単に表示する

Node-REDヘデータをリアルタイムに飛ばし、受け取ったデータをいろいろ加工したりどこかへ転送したりする際、データがちゃんと受け取られているかを確認するためにdebugノードにデータを入力することが多いかと思います。

ですが、デバッグのタブってどんどんデータがたまっていくので、今の値だけを見たい(リアルタイムに受信できているかを確認したい)時って、見づらくありませんか?
私は見づらいです。

なので、ある入力データの値を表示するだけのfunctionノードを作ってみました。

funciton_node
node.status({text:"" + msg.payload.path.to.value});
return;

コードはこれだけです。

このfunctionノードに下記JSONデータが入力してみます。

input.json
{
  "path": {
    "to": {
      "value": 77
    }
  }
}

ノードの表示が下記のようになります。
image.png

本当は、テキスト(「some value」のところ)を変えたかったんですけど、どなたかご存知ではないですか?